2007 Mazda 6 vs. 2006 Seat Alhambra
To start off, 2007 Mazda 6 is newer by 1 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2006 Seat Alhambra.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2006 Seat Alhambra would be higher. At 2,792 cc (6 cylinders), 2006 Seat Alhambra is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2006 Seat Alhambra (201 HP @ 6200 RPM) has 62 more horse power than 2007 Mazda 6. (139 HP @ 6000 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2006 Seat Alhambra should accelerate faster than 2007 Mazda 6.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2006 Seat Alhambra weights approximately 290 kg more than 2007 Mazda 6.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2006 Seat Alhambra is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2007 Mazda 6.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2006 Seat Alhambra will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2006 Seat Alhambra (265 Nm @ 3400 RPM) has 84 more torque (in Nm) than 2007 Mazda 6. (181 Nm @ 4500 RPM). This means 2006 Seat Alhambra will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2007 Mazda 6.
